Who is Judo Bank?
Judo Bank was founded in October 2016 by former NAB bankers David Hornery and Joseph Healy, built specifically to lend to small and medium-sized businesses after the major banks pulled back from relationship-based SME lending. It received a full banking licence from APRA in April 2019 and listed on the ASX in November 2021 (ticker JDO), the first fully licensed Australian bank to IPO in 25 years.
Judo's core business remains SME lending, backed by personal term deposits and, more recently, a home loan offering. It has no branch network, operating through relationship bankers and its digital platform from its Melbourne head office rather than shopfronts.
Who suits a Judo Bank home loan?
Judo Bank tends to suit business owners already banking with Judo for commercial lending who want to keep their home loan under the same relationship, rather than borrowers shopping purely on rate. Its home loan pricing in our index generally sits well above the mainstream market average, so compare its comparison rate carefully against the sharpest rates in the table above before choosing it for a standalone home loan.
